FAQ

What is a Math Lab Survey survey and why is it important?

A Math Lab Survey survey is a structured tool that collects feedback about math lab experiences. It asks participants about instructional quality, resource availability, and overall lab support. The survey is designed to capture opinions from students and instructors on what works well and what may need improvement. It ensures that each response adds to a clear picture of the lab's effectiveness and helps guide future educational strategies.

Regular feedback through such surveys enables targeted improvements in lab sessions and teaching methods.
Key tips include keeping questions clear and specific and ensuring that every question serves a purpose. This careful design leads to practical insights, improved student engagement, and enhanced learning outcomes in math lab settings.

What are some good examples of Math Lab Survey survey questions?

Good examples of Math Lab Survey survey questions include ones that are clear and direct. For instance, asking "How clear were the instructions during the lab session?" or "Did the lab equipment meet your learning needs?" helps gather focused feedback on key areas. Questions regarding the overall support provided by the lab and the appropriateness of session content are also effective and straightforward.

Another useful approach is to include questions about the ease of accessing assistance and opinions on session scheduling.
Consider using simple rating scales or open-ended prompts like "What improvements would you suggest?" to encourage detailed feedback. This method provides balanced insights that can drive pragmatic improvements in math lab sessions.

How do I create effective Math Lab Survey survey questions?

To create effective Math Lab Survey survey questions, start with clear, concise language that directly reflects your goals. Focus on one topic per question, whether it is the clarity of lab instructions, resource availability, or overall satisfaction. Ensure the wording is unambiguous and avoid combining multiple ideas in one question. This helps respondents understand and answer each query accurately, gathering actionable insights for the math lab experience.

It is also useful to pilot your questions with a small group before full distribution.
Revise based on feedback and eliminate any confusing items. This iterative process leads to a well-structured survey that reliably captures participant opinions and facilitates meaningful improvements in lab operations.

How many questions should a Math Lab Survey survey include?

There is no strict rule, but a balanced Math Lab Survey survey usually includes about 8 to 15 focused questions. This quantity is enough to cover important topics without overwhelming respondents. Each question should address a specific aspect of the math lab experience like instructional clarity, facility quality, or resource effectiveness. A concise survey helps to maintain respondents' attention and increases the likelihood of complete, thoughtful answers.

It is important to test the survey length during a pilot phase to ensure it is manageable.
Adjust the number of questions based on initial feedback while keeping the survey focused on key improvement areas. This approach not only improves response rates but also provides reliable feedback to enhance math lab operations.

When is the best time to conduct a Math Lab Survey survey (and how often)?

The best time to conduct a Math Lab Survey survey is at the end of a lab session or after a significant learning period, such as the end of a semester. This timing captures fresh impressions and detailed experiences from participants. Regular surveys help educators monitor progress and make timely adjustments to lab practices. The key is to align survey distribution with critical evaluation points when feedback is most relevant.

It is beneficial to schedule surveys at consistent intervals, for example once each term, to track improvements over time.
Regularly reviewing survey responses allows for gradual, data-driven refinements to lab sessions. Such periodic evaluations ensure that the math lab continuously meets the evolving needs of students and instructors.

What are common mistakes to avoid in Math Lab Survey surveys?

Common mistakes in Math Lab Survey surveys include using vague language, combining multiple topics in one question, and making the survey unnecessarily long. Such errors can confuse respondents and lead to inconsistent data. Avoid using ambiguous terms or technical jargon that may not be clear to all participants. It is equally important to ensure that each question is directly related to a specific aspect of the math lab experience to maintain clarity and focus.

Additionally, not testing the survey before full distribution is a frequent oversight.
Always pilot the survey with a small group to identify and fix potential issues. Careful review and elimination of redundant questions streamline the survey and lead to more accurate, actionable feedback.
